ISO 13485 Certification demonstrates that an organization has established and implemented a Quality Management System (QMS) designed specifically for the medical device industry. ISO 13485:2016 provides requirements for organizations involved in the design, production, installation, and servicing of medical devices and related services. The standard focuses on consistent processes, regulatory requirements, risk management, and the safety and effectiveness of medical devices.
What Is ISO 13485 Certification?
ISO 13485 Certification involves an independent assessment of an organization's QMS against the requirements of ISO 13485. The standard is specifically tailored to the medical device sector and places strong emphasis on regulatory compliance, risk management, process controls, and product safety.
ISO 13485:2016 remains the current edition and was reviewed and confirmed in 2025.

Key Requirements of ISO 13485
Important areas of an ISO 13485 Quality Management System include:
- Quality management system requirements
- Management responsibility and quality objectives
- Resource management and employee competence
- Training and awareness
- Product realization and process controls
- Medical device risk management
- Design and development controls
- Supplier and purchasing controls
- Production and service provision
- Identification and traceability
- Monitoring and measurement
- Complaint handling and feedback
- Internal audits
- Control of nonconforming products
- Corrective and preventive actions
- Continual improvement
The standard places particular importance on risk management and regulatory requirements throughout the medical device supply chain.

ISO 13485 Certification Process
The process generally begins with a gap assessment to identify differences between existing practices and ISO 13485 requirements. The organization then develops or improves its QMS, establishes appropriate procedures and controls, trains personnel, and maintains required records.
Internal audits and management reviews are conducted to evaluate system effectiveness. Identified nonconformities should be addressed before an independent certification body conducts the external certification audit.
Choosing an ISO 13485 Certification Provider
Organizations should consider the certification body's accreditation, medical device industry experience, auditor competence, regulatory knowledge, audit methodology, and certification process. The certification body should provide an independent and objective assessment of the organization's QMS.
It is also important to understand that ISO itself does not perform certification; certification is conducted by independent third-party certification bodies.
